The Business Software Alliance is the voice of the world’s commercial software industry and its hardware partners before governments and in the international marketplace. BSA programs foster technology innovation through education and policy initiatives that promote copyright protection, cyber security, trade, and e-commerce.
More than 1 of every 3 copies of software installed worldwide is pirated. Software piracy is not only a crime, but it can harm those who use it.
Business Software Alliance (BSA) is a nonprofit trade association created to advance
the goals of the software industry and its hardware partners. It is the foremost
organization dedicated to promoting a safe and legal digital world. Headquartered
in Washington, DC, BSA is active in more than 80 countries, with dedicated staff
in 11 offices around the globe: Brussels, London, Munich, Beijing, Delhi, Jakarta,
Kuala Lumpur, Taipei, Tokyo, Singapore, and São Paulo.

BSA’s global mission is to promote a long-term legislative and legal environment in which the industry can prosper and to provide a unified voice for its members around the world. BSA’s programs foster innovation, growth, and a competitive marketplace for commercial software and related technologies. BSA members are optimistic about the future of the industry, but believe that the future does not simply unfold. And, we agree that it is critical for companies to work together to address the key issues that affect innovation.
